ARTURO LUZ National Artist for Visual Arts 1997 Arturo Luz painter sculptor and designer for more than 40 years created masterpieces that exemplify an ideal of sublime austerity in expression and formFrom the Carnival series of the late 1950s to the recent Cyclist paintings Luz produced works that elevated Filipino aesthetic vision to new heights of sophisticated simplicity. He was referring to Bagong Taon which won first prize in the 1952 AAP Art Association of the Phils competition. Under Article 1200, What is the right of choice, as a general rule, that is given to the debtor. Bagong Taon (translated: New Year) is a 1952 painting made by Arturo Luz in oil on lawanit (ply wood). He won first prize for Bagong Taon in the 5th AAP Annual Competition in modern painting. Influenced by Modernist painters such as Paul Klee, he has worked in a variety of styles and techniques in varying degrees of abstraction to create playful geometric figures and forms.He was born on November 20, 1926 in Manila, Republic of the Phillipines and went on . . Artist Arturo Luz was the Founding Director of the Metropolitan Museum of Manila in 1976 and worked there for 10 years. He also studied at the Brooklyn Museum Art School in New York during the 1950s, and then at the Acadmie de la Grande Chaumire in Paris the following year. He said, I have very little to say about what I dono clutter, no nonsense, no storiesjust simple, plain abstract objects. He is considered a pioneer of the Philippine Neo-realist movement (1950s-1960s) along with fellow Filipino artist Fernando Zobel de Ayala, for their adoption of a modernist approach to interpreting daily life in their native land.
